There are 3 kinds of cabinets: customized, semi-stock, and supply closets. Customized kitchen cabinetry features the highest cost tag since it's developed specifically to fit your room. Semi-stock cupboards can use you a larger variety of coatings, timber options, and devices and are in the mid-tier price range. The most affordable yet however top notch types of closets are supply cupboards.


Shaker cabinets are the most popular design of kitchen area closets. What the finest cooking area closets are depends greatly on your taste, budget, and job timeline.

After the granite is reduced and brightened, it's treated with an impregnating sealant that makes the countertop stain immune. This therapy generally lasts five to 10 years, but make certain to use a stone cleanernot an abrasive cleanserfor everyday cleaning. Many granite counters are polished to a shiny shine, however you can likewise request a refined finish, which is much less glossy and even more of a matte sheen.

A kitchen with brand-new white farmhouse closets. $50 to $150 per square foot set up on standard. Countertop costs vary dramatically by product. Quartz and granite are prominent options priced at the mid to high-end of the range. Laminate kitchen counters are the cheapest yet the very least long lasting and don't include value to a home.

Ask these questions to aid you discover the very best cupboard and kitchen counter installers: The number of cooking areas have you redesigned in the previous year? Do you have a profile of previous projects I can evaluate? Can you provide a listing of referrals for me to call? Which kinds of brand-new cabinets do you advise for my cooking area? What are the finest kitchen counter options in my budget plan? Does the quote include license charges, materials, labor, and cleaning? What additional expenses might come up during a job similar to this? For how long will the task take? What permits do I need, and will you acquire them? Do you call for a deposit, and just how much is it? Can I get a labor guarantee? If so, what does it cover?.
